Space Shuttle Atlantis returned to Earth, landing at NASA’s KSC at 6:21 a.m. (EDT) to complete its 12-day mission (STS-115). During that mission, the crew had resumed construction of the ISS after a four-year hiatus. The mission highlights included three spacewalks to install the P3/P4 truss on the ISS and to prepare new solar panels on that truss for future production of electricity at the orbiting space station.

NASA, “Mission Archives: STS-115.”
